The Metal Museum is the only institution in the United States devoted exclusively to the art and craft of fine metalwork. Unlike conventional art museums, it isn't just a place where art is displayed; it's a place where art is made. At the Metal Museum you can see works of art, see artists work, learn the craft and craft the art. Enjoy special exhibitions and selections from the permanent collection, tour the sculpture garden and metal shop and watch artists in the smithy and foundry, all while taking in the magnificent view of the Mississippi River.
